About Shuxuan Li
Shuxuan Li is a scholar working on Water Science and Technology, Mechanical Engineering and Materials Chemistry, having authored 35 papers that have together received 1.6k indexed citations. Recurring topics across this work include Membrane Separation Technologies (25 papers), Membrane Separation and Gas Transport (17 papers) and Covalent Organic Framework Applications (13 papers). The work is most often cited by research in Water Science and Technology (1.4k citations), Biomedical Engineering (995 citations) and Mechanical Engineering (806 citations). Shuxuan Li has collaborated with scholars based in China, India and United States. Frequent co-authors include Baowei Su, Can Li, Lihui Han, Michael Z. Hu, Xueli Gao, Congjie Gao, Jinmiao Zhang, Bishnupada Mandal, Xinghua Lv and Shaoxiao Liu. Their work appears in journals such as Journal of Hazardous Materials, Chemical Engineering Journal and ACS Applied Materials & Interfaces.
